Subhash Pinnapola takes leadership of Leo Burnett Colombo’s Creative Team

Leo Burnett Colombo announced the appointment of Subhash Pinnapola as the leader of its Creative Team. The appointment recognises the commitment and the passion of this true-blue Burnetter towards the company and to creative excellence.



Subhash is currently the Executive Creative Director of Sri Lanka’s most awarded ad agency. Subhash’s journey at Leo Burnett began nine years ago when he came on board as a Creative Director and was later elevated to Senior Creative Director and then Executive Creative Director (ECD). His ideas have helped many local and international brands grow to positions of market leadership.

Subhash has a unique understanding of the local ethos through the intimate knowledge he has of the Sri Lankan consumer. This rare skill has proven to be an invaluable asset that has aided Subhashto win numerous accolades. The most recent of these tributes was to be named as runner-up as South Asia’sBest Creative Director and to be rated as Sri Lanka’s No. 1 Creative Director by Campaign Asia, the region’s most respected trade publication.

Subhash also has the rare honour of being the first Sri Lankan to serve on an international jury of an awards festival. Moreover his work has won him metals at Adfest, Spikes, Cannes Lions, Appies, Goa Fest and other festivals. Another significant achievement was the inclusion of his commercial for the Sri Lanka Eye Donation Society in the Gunn Report as one of the 100 Best Ideas of 2011; this was the first Sri Lankan ad to be thus featured in this prestigious review.

As one of the most awarded local admen, Subhash’s work has raised the bar of Sri Lankan advertising, pushing it into the international limelight, and getting the country noticed by twittering juries. Subhash’s work also scored Leo Burnett, Colombo, its first ever GPC 7+ and GPC 8 Ball. This year, under Subhash’s stewardship as Executive Creative Director, the agency also won the most prestigious accolade of being named by Campaign Asia as South Asia’s Creative Agency of the Year at the Agency of the Year Awards in 2012.
